Reach for this book when you want to ground your child in a sense of absolute belonging and spiritual security. It is especially helpful for toddlers who are beginning to notice differences in others or who need a gentle reminder that they are loved exactly as they are. Based on the classic Sunday School song, this book uses simple, rhythmic verse to celebrate the diversity of the world's children through a lens of faith. The narrative emphasizes that every child, regardless of their background or appearance, is precious. It serves as a soothing bedtime read or a first introduction to Christian concepts of universal love. For parents, it offers a way to introduce the idea of a higher power that values diversity, helping to build a foundation of self-worth and empathy for others from a very young age.
